π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

10 items
  • 4 pieces Salmon fillets
  • 2 teaspoons Ch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on Paprika
  • 1.5 teaspoons Salt
  • 0.5 teaspoons Black pepper
  • 5 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 1.5 pounds Baby potatoes
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h parsley
  • 2 pieces Lemon wedges

πŸ“ Instructions

10 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 425Β°F (220Β°C).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per or foil for easy cleanup.

2

Wash and dry the baby potatoes. Cut larger potatoes into halves or quarters to ensure even cooking.

3

Place the potatoes on the prepared baking sheet. Drizzle with 3 tablespoons of olive oil, sprinkle with 1 teaspoon of salt and 0.25 teaspoons of black pepper, and toss to coat evenly. Spread the potatoes out in a single layer.

4

Roast the potatoes in the oven for 15 minutes while you prepare the salmon.

5

In a small bowl, mix together the chili powder, garlic powder, paprika, 0.5 teaspoon salt, and 0.25 teaspoon black pepper to create the spice rub.

6

Pat the salmon fillets dry with a paper towel. Brush each fillet lightly with 2 tablespoons of olive oil, then coat evenly with the chili spice rub on both sides.

7

After the potatoes have roasted for 15 minutes, remove the baking sheet from the oven. Push the potatoes to one side to make room for the salmon.

8

Place the seasoned salmon fillets on the baking sheet, skin-side down if applicable, next to the potatoes.

9

Return the baking sheet to the oven and roast for another 12-15 minutes, or until the salmon flakes easily with a fork and the potatoes are crispy and golden brown.

10

Sprinkle the roasted potatoes with fresh parsley for garnish. Serve the salmon and potatoes immediately with lemon wedges on the side for a fresh, zesty finish.
